1. Cigar City Brewing

Topping the list is brewery Cigar City Brewing. Located at 3924 W. Spruce St., it's the highest-rated business in the neighborhood, boasting 4.5 stars out of 774 reviews on Yelp.
Best known for its brews, tours and tasting room, this spot recently added a full-service kitchen. The menu now features starters, salads, sandwiches and sweets. Popular offerings include a Bavarian beer house pretzel, a sweet potato and chipotle veggie burger and a margherita flatbread .
2. Eddie V's Prime Seafood And Steaks

Next up is lounge and steakhouse Eddie V's Prime Seafood and Steaks, which offers seafood and more, situated at 4400 W. Boy Scout Blvd. With 4.5 stars out of 621 reviews on Yelp, it's proven to be a local favorite.
The menu emphasizes a catch of the day along with caviar, Chilean sea bass, butter poached lobster with mashed potatoes and more. Finish off your meal with the banana foster dessert.
3. Roy's Restaurant

Asian fusion and Hawaiian spot Roy's Restaurant, which offers seafood and more, is another top choice. Yelpers give the business, located at 4342 W. Boy Scout Blvd., four stars out of 403 reviews.
Tokyo-born Roy Yamaguchi, Roy's restaurant founder, is known for "blending classic techniques with adventurous Pacific rim flavors," notes the business' website.
Feast on lump crab cake, grilled filet mignon and lobster. Specialty cocktails include Hawaiian martinis and a 1988 drink. For dessert, try the pineapple upside down cake or the macadamia nut pudding. (View the full offerings here.)
4. Flemings Prime Steakhouse & Wine Bar

Flemings Prime Steakhouse & Wine Bar, a steakhouse and wine bar that offers seafood and more, is another neighborhood go-to, with four stars out of 398 Yelp reviews. Head over to 4322 W. Boy Scout Blvd. to see for yourself.
This upscale restaurant offers hand-crafted cocktails, ranging from the Old Cuban to the Blueberry Lemon Drop. For lunch, try the salmon Mediterranean salad or California burger. Dinner options include starters like a chilled seafood tower and lobster bisque soup, eight cuts of steak, as well as popular desserts such as the key lime pie and triple layer chocolate and caramel cake.
